Why California is a Unique Fit for Storefront Renovation Grants
The Individual Grant to Support Property and Business Owners is particularly well-suited for California due to its distinct economic and demographic characteristics. One key factor is the state's diverse economy, with a strong presence of small businesses that drive innovation and job creation. According to the California Governor's Office of Business and Economic Development, small businesses account for over 99% of all businesses in the state. The City of Fillmore, with its neighborhood commercial corridor, is an exemplary case where such grants can revitalize local businesses and enhance the overall shopping experience.
Regional Characteristics and State Agencies Supporting Business Growth
California's unique geography, with its extensive coastline and varied regional economies, presents both opportunities and challenges for businesses. The state's coastal economy, for instance, is a significant driver of tourism, which in turn affects the viability of businesses in areas like the City of Fillmore. The California Department of Housing and Community Development (HCD) is a key state agency that supports businesses and community development through various programs, including those that could complement the Individual Grant to Support Property and Business Owners. For example, HCD's California Main Street Program provides funding for downtown revitalization efforts, which could align with the goals of the storefront renovation grants. Moreover, the California Coastal Commission plays a crucial role in managing the state's coastal resources, indirectly affecting businesses in coastal areas.

Aligning with State Priorities and Economic Development Goals
The Individual Grant to Support Property and Business Owners aligns with California's broader economic development goals, particularly in enhancing the attractiveness and competitiveness of local business districts. By supporting the renovation of storefronts, these grants not only improve the aesthetic appeal of commercial corridors but also contribute to a more vibrant and inviting shopping environment. This is in line with the state's efforts to promote economic growth, as highlighted by the 'business grants California' search trend, indicating a strong interest in such programs.
The grant program's focus on assisting individual businesses to renovate their storefronts directly supports the state's priorities in community development and economic revitalization.
